Post subject:  error with rerun default experiment

Hi,
I loaded the PRECIS with the default experiment. But, after a month of round, the model stops. After that, I click on "Run PRECIS => Rerun from completed time" for the experiment to continue from where he left off, but appears the error message (attached). Could you please help to solve this problem?

Firstly, it is normal for PRECIS to stop after the first month. We call this month the 'NRUN', and the idea behind it is that you have a quick check that everything is as expected before beginning a long simulation. To continue the simulation after the first month, you can either type
Quote:
restart [runid]
on the command line, or equivalently by clicking on
Quote:
Run PRECIS --> Restart
in the PRECIS user interface.

The 'rerun from completed time' option is not what you want. Situations where this command is useful, are restarting PRECIS after a 'messy crash' (e.g. after a power cut), or to rerun part of a completed simulation again (perhaps to output some extra diagnostics in a month where PRECIS simulates an interesting weather system).
